Q:

Which substance contains metallic bonds?

A) C6H12O6 B) Hg
C) H2O D) NaCl
 
Answer & Explanation Answer: B) Hg

Explanation:

Metallic bond is a bond between two metal atoms. Here in the given option Hg is the only metal with metallic bond.

Q:

Which measurement depends on gravitational force?

A) Mass B) Weight
C) Height D) All of the above
 
Answer & Explanation Answer: B) Weight

Explanation:

We know that,

Weight W = mg. That is mass times gravitational force.

Q:

Buenos Aires largest shopping mall is called

A) Alto Palermo B) Santa Fe
C) Coronel Diaz D) Abasto
 
Answer & Explanation Answer: D) Abasto

Explanation:

Abasto Shopping is the largest mall in the capital city of Argentina, Buenos Aires with over 230 shops, movie theaters and an enormous food court.

Q:

In which place India's first HIV case reported in 1986?

A) Bangalore B) Delhi
C) Hyderabad D) Chennai
 
Answer & Explanation Answer: D) Chennai

Explanation:

In Chennai, Tamil Nadu place India's first HIV case reported in 1986 amongst the female sex workers.
